1. Understanding Wholehearted Dog Food
Wholehearted is a dog food brand exclusively owned and operated by Petco, a major pet retailer in the United States. Known for its commitment to quality and affordability, Wholehearted offers a range of products designed to meet the nutritional needs of various dogs, from puppies to seniors. The brand has expanded its offerings in recent years, including a fresh food option, showcasing its dedication to providing comprehensive dietary solutions. Wholehearted aims to provide nutrition comparable to higher-end brands, without the premium price tag.
1.1. Who Manufactures Wholehearted Dog Food?
Petco manufactures and distributes Wholehearted dog food. Petco owns all rights to the food. WholeHearted can primarily be found in Petco stores and on Petco’s website. International Pet Supplies and Distribution, Inc. (IPSD), a subsidiary of Petco Animal Supplies Inc. also distributes WholeHearted. IPSD has its headquarters in San Diego, California.
1.2. Where Is Wholehearted Dog Food Made?
WholeHearted dog food is manufactured in the United States in facilities owned by Petco. However, the company sources the ingredients internationally through IPSD. Petco buys certain ingredients from the international market, imports them via IPSD, and then manufactures the food in the United States.

2. Primary Ingredients in Wholehearted Dog Food: A Detailed Analysis
A comprehensive review of WholeHearted dog food, toppers, and treats reveals that they consist mainly of natural ingredients with limited fillers or artificial additives. While some recipes include animal meal (such as beef meal or chicken meal), these are generally considered acceptable. WholeHearted prides itself on being grain-free.
2.1. The Role of Real Animal Meat
The main ingredient in all WholeHearted products is real meat, varying depending on the chosen flavor. WholeHearted Active Performance High-Protein Chicken & Rice Recipe, for example, lists real chicken and brown rice as its primary ingredients. This emphasis on real meat is encouraging for pet owners seeking high-quality dog food. It also ensures the food is palatable for even the pickiest eaters.
2.2. Understanding Lentils in Grain-Free Formulas
WholeHearted Grain-Free All Life Stages Beef & Pea Formula Dry Dog Food contains a significant amount of lentils, which, while not grains, are similar in composition. This recipe includes substantial quantities of peas, lentils, chickpeas, and sweet potatoes. While these ingredients are not inherently harmful to dogs, their prominence raises questions about the “grain-free” claim. Although peas are not toxic to dogs, they are a major component of this recipe. Peas are being potentially linked to dilated cardiomyopathy, a heart condition in dogs. It is advisable to consult with your veterinarian to determine whether this formula is appropriate for your dog.
2.3. Benefits of Broth as a Filler
Instead of using grains and byproducts, WholeHearted often incorporates broth as a filler. Broth is a simple, flavorful ingredient that dogs enjoy. The meal toppers primarily consist of water and meat (lamb, beef, or chicken), essentially making them broth-based. Wet food also contains a notable amount of beef broth, enhancing the flavor without the need for synthetic or artificial additives.
2.4. The Probiotic Power of Live Microorganisms
WholeHearted enhances the immune health of dogs by adding live microorganisms to some of its foods, including WholeHearted Grain-Free All Life Stages Beef & Pea Formula Dry Dog Food. These microorganisms are potent probiotics that support gut health. Such additives are common in other high-quality products, such as The Farmer’s Dog, and WholeHearted offers a more affordable alternative.
2.5. Significance of Nutritional Boosters
A thorough examination of WholeHearted’s ingredient lists reveals no major red flags. Ingredients like Pyridoxine Hydrochloride and Thiamine Mononitrate are actually vitamins and enzyme boosters that address deficiencies such as B1 deficiency. These nutritional boosters demonstrate Petco’s commitment to enhancing the health benefits of its WholeHearted line by including a variety of essential vitamins and minerals.

4. Recall History of WholeHearted Dog Food
As of the current date, WholeHearted has not experienced any recalls. This is particularly noteworthy considering the brand’s rapid growth and introduction of numerous recipes in a relatively short period. 5.2. WholeHearted Active Performance High-Protein Chicken & Rice Dry Dog Food
Designed for active and large dogs, WholeHearted Active Performance High-Protein Chicken & Rice Recipe Dry Dog Food contains 30% protein and 20% fat to support an active lifestyle. The main ingredients include chicken, brown rice, chicken by-product meal, white rice, chicken meal, and chicken fat, all of which are natural and beneficial for dogs. With 89% of its protein derived from animal sources, this formula closely mimics a natural canine diet. Gradual introduction of this high-protein, high-fat diet is recommended to avoid digestive upset.

5.3. WholeHearted Grain-Free All Life Stages Beef & Pea Formula Dry Dog Food
WholeHearted Grain-Free All Life Stages Beef & Pea Formula Dry Dog Food is designed for dogs of all ages and sizes, using natural ingredients for a well-rounded diet. Key ingredients include beef, beef meal, lentils, pea flour, chickpeas, peas, and sweet potatoes. It provides a balanced nutritional profile with a minimum of 24.0% crude protein, 14% crude fat, and 5.0% crude fiber. While it is slightly heavy on lentils and peas, it remains palatable and nutritious.

5.5. WholeHearted Culinary Cuts Chicken Recipe Jerky Dog Treats
The WholeHearted Culinary Cuts Chicken Recipe Jerky Dog Treats are made from chicken, vegetable glycerin, salt, and rosemary extract. These treats consist of 55% crude protein, 2% crude fat, 1.5% crude fiber, and 22% moisture. Their large size and appealing shape make them a hit with dogs.
